Why multidisciplinary wound care improves patient outcomes
Coordinated wound care teams produce measurable improvements across four patient-level domains: amputation prevention, diagnostic accuracy, healing speed, and resource efficiency. Each benefit is backed by observational and cohort data, though the evidence base is still largely non-randomized.
Reduced major amputations. The systematic review cited above is the clearest signal. Single-center program reports have described absolute reductions in major-amputation rates ranging from minimal change to up to 51% in select high-performing settings, though results vary considerably by patient population and team composition. Treat those upper-end figures as aspirational benchmarks, not guarantees.
Improved diagnostic accuracy. A retrospective cohort study from Ontario found that interprofessional team assessments improved healability classification, increased vascular and offloading assessments, and detected infection more reliably than conventional community care. Getting the diagnosis right earlier changes the entire treatment trajectory.
Faster healing and fewer advanced interventions. The same Ontario cohort reported better healing outcomes despite a shorter follow-up window, and noted that fewer high-cost, advanced wound-care modalities were required after comprehensive MDT assessment. That last point matters for patients and payers alike.
Better patient education and adherence. Multiple reviews report that MDTs improve the consistency of messages patients receive, which directly supports long-term adherence to offloading, glucose management, and wound-care routines. When everyone on the team says the same thing, patients are more likely to follow through.
- Reduced major-amputation rates (31/33 studies)
- Improved healability classification and vascular assessment
- Faster healing with fewer high-cost modalities
- Better infection detection and triage
- Consistent patient education across disciplines

Who is on a multidisciplinary wound team?
Most well-structured MDTs organize members into a nuclear core and an ancillary layer, with one clinician serving as the coordinating “captain.” Understanding who does what helps you ask better questions at your first visit.
Core (nuclear) members:
- Podiatrist or foot and ankle surgeon — leads wound assessment, performs debridement, manages offloading, and coordinates surgical decisions
- Vascular surgeon or interventional radiologist — evaluates and treats arterial insufficiency; performs revascularization when indicated
- Infectious disease physician or clinical microbiologist — guides antibiotic selection, interprets cultures, and manages deep or systemic infections
- Endocrinologist or diabetologist — optimizes glycemic control, which directly affects wound-healing capacity
- Wound-care nurse or certified wound specialist — manages dressings, monitors wound progress, and provides hands-on patient education
Ancillary members (involved as needed):
- Physical or occupational therapist — addresses mobility, strength, and functional recovery after wound closure or amputation
- Registered dietitian — supports nutritional status, which is a modifiable factor in healing speed
- Prosthetist or orthotist — fits custom offloading devices, post-amputation prosthetics, and therapeutic footwear
- Social worker or care coordinator — connects patients with transportation, home-care resources, and insurance navigation
The “captain” role, typically held by the podiatrist or a wound-care physician, is not just administrative. Teams that designate a single coordinator and use a clear nuclear/ancillary structure achieve faster decision-making and clearer follow-up responsibilities. Without that role, patients often fall through the gaps between specialists.

The four clinical tasks MDTs address and why each one matters
Every well-functioning MDT consistently tackles four overlapping clinical problems. Addressing them simultaneously, rather than one at a time, is what separates coordinated care from a sequential referral chain.
Glycemic control
Elevated blood glucose impairs neutrophil function, slows collagen synthesis, and reduces tissue perfusion. The endocrinologist or diabetologist on the team targets hemoglobin A1c and adjusts medications in parallel with wound treatment, rather than waiting for glucose to improve before addressing the wound. That parallel approach shortens the overall healing timeline.
Local wound management
Wound debridement removes necrotic tissue, reduces bacterial burden, and stimulates the wound edge to advance. Offloading, typically with a total-contact cast or removable cast walker, redistributes plantar pressure away from the ulcer. These two interventions form the mechanical foundation of local wound management and are most effective when performed consistently by a trained podiatrist within the MDT.

Vascular disease assessment and management
Ischemia is present in a substantial proportion of diabetic foot ulcers and is one of the strongest predictors of amputation. The MDT’s vascular specialist performs ankle-brachial index testing, toe pressures, or duplex ultrasound to quantify perfusion. When arterial disease is significant, revascularization (angioplasty or bypass) may restore enough blood flow to allow healing. Without this assessment, wounds are treated as if perfusion is adequate when it is not.
“Consistently and synchronously addressing all contributing factors — vascular status, infection, glycemic control, and local wound environment — and providing timely care through referral pathways and care algorithms is what the evidence repeatedly credits for improved outcomes.” (Sciencedirect.com, descriptive MDT review)
Infection control
Deep infection, osteomyelitis, and systemic sepsis require prompt, targeted treatment. The MDT’s infectious disease specialist interprets tissue cultures (not just swabs), selects appropriate antibiotics, and determines whether surgical debridement or bone resection is needed. Coordinated infection control in podiatry within the MDT framework prevents the escalation from localized infection to limb-threatening sepsis.

The V.I.P. framework (vascular, infection, plantar pressure) captures these three wound-level tasks and is embedded in routine MDT workflows so that all three are evaluated at every visit rather than addressed one at a time.
How is multidisciplinary wound care organized operationally?
The operational structure of an MDT is what converts good intentions into consistent outcomes. Care algorithms and explicit referral pathways are repeatedly cited as the core enablers of MDT success because they reduce delays and standardize who gets which intervention and when.
Referral pathway (typical flow):
Primary care or emergency department identifies a non-healing wound → triage by severity (wound depth, infection signs, ischemia) → referral to MDT hub → initial comprehensive assessment within a defined window (often 48–72 hours for urgent presentations) → care plan assigned with named captain → follow-up cadence set.
Care algorithms translate that pathway into clinical decisions. A well-designed algorithm specifies: if the wound is Wagner Grade 2 or higher, obtain vascular imaging; if probe-to-bone is positive, order MRI for osteomyelitis; if A1c is above a threshold, escalate endocrinology involvement. Algorithms reduce clinician-to-clinician variability and prevent the most common delay: waiting for one specialist’s report before engaging the next.
Team meeting cadence varies by program. High-functioning MDTs typically hold weekly case conferences where the captain presents new and complex cases, ancillary members update their findings, and the group agrees on the next intervention. This structure means a patient’s vascular result, glucose trend, and wound measurement are reviewed together, not in separate clinic notes that no one synthesizes.

Who should see a multidisciplinary wound team, and when?
Most patients with a non-healing wound of any type benefit from at least a single MDT assessment. For diabetic foot ulcers and complex wounds, the threshold for referral should be low.
Indications for MDT referral:
- Diabetic foot ulcer that has not improved meaningfully after 2–4 weeks of standard care
- Any wound with signs of deep infection (warmth, erythema extending beyond the wound margin, purulent drainage, fever)
- Suspected or confirmed ischemia (absent pulses, cool foot, rest pain, low ankle-brachial index)
- Wound with exposed tendon, joint capsule, or bone
- Recurrent ulceration at the same site
- Post-amputation stump wound that is failing to heal
- Wound in a patient with poorly controlled diabetes (A1c above 8–9%), renal disease, or immunosuppression
- Any wound that has failed two or more courses of treatment without a clear explanation
Immediate red flags requiring urgent referral (same day or emergency department):
- Spreading cellulitis with systemic signs (fever, elevated white blood cell count, confusion)
- Crepitus or gas in soft tissue (suggests necrotizing infection)
- Rapidly worsening wound with blackened tissue
- Acute limb ischemia (sudden cold, pale, pulseless foot)
Timing matters. Patients referred after infection has become systemic or after ischemia has caused irreversible tissue loss face worse outcomes even with full MDT support. Early triage preserves the team’s ability to prevent major amputation.

What can you expect at a multidisciplinary wound care visit?
The first MDT visit is more thorough than a standard office appointment. Plan for 60–90 minutes and bring everything that documents your wound’s history.
What happens at the initial assessment:
- Detailed medical history (diabetes duration, prior amputations, medications, kidney function)
- Wound measurement and photography (length, width, depth, tissue type, exudate)
- Vascular testing (ankle-brachial index, toe pressures, or referral for duplex ultrasound)
- Neurological assessment (monofilament testing for peripheral neuropathy)
- Laboratory work (complete blood count, metabolic panel, A1c, inflammatory markers)
- Offloading assessment and device fitting or prescription
- Patient education session covering home wound care, glucose monitoring, and warning signs
What to bring:
- Your current shoes and any orthotics
- A glucose log or continuous glucose monitor download from the past 30 days
- A complete medication list including supplements
- Any prior wound photographs or measurements
- A list of questions about the care plan and expected timeline
Typical care pathway timeline:
| Phase | Timeframe | Key activities |
|---|---|---|
| Initial assessment | Week 1 | Full workup, vascular testing, labs, offloading |
| Early intervention | Weeks 2–4 | Debridement, dressing protocol, glycemic adjustment |
| Reassessment | Week 4–6 | Wound measurement, vascular follow-up, algorithm review |
| Advanced intervention (if needed) | Weeks 6–12 | Revascularization, surgical debridement, skin grafting |
| Maintenance and prevention | Ongoing | Footwear, monitoring, recurrence prevention |
Timelines vary by wound severity, vascular status, and patient adherence. A wound with adequate perfusion and controlled glucose can close in 6–12 weeks; an ischemic wound requiring revascularization may take considerably longer.
What are the limitations and access barriers to MDT wound care?
MDT care is not universally available, and the evidence supporting it, while consistent in direction, has real methodological limits.
Evidence limitations:
- The majority of studies are observational; randomized controlled trials are sparse, as noted in a systematic review of team-based wound care for pressure injuries
- Team composition varies widely across studies, making direct comparisons difficult
- Many single-center reports reflect highly motivated programs that may not generalize to average settings
- Publication bias likely inflates reported effect sizes
Access and resource barriers:
- Full MDTs require coordinated scheduling across multiple specialists, which is logistically demanding
- Rural and underserved areas often lack on-site vascular surgery or infectious disease coverage
- Insurance coverage for MDT visits varies; some payers reimburse team-based care poorly compared to individual specialist visits
- Unclear role definitions and integration gaps between hospital and community settings remain common barriers, according to a scoping review of MDT roles and facilitators
Practical alternatives when full MDT access is limited:
- An optimized single-provider pathway with a podiatrist who has established referral relationships with vascular and infectious disease specialists
- Telehealth MDT hubs, where a regional center advises local providers remotely; this model has shown promise in shrinking access gaps for patients in underserved areas
- Referral to a regional academic medical center or wound-care center of excellence for a one-time comprehensive assessment, with ongoing care managed locally

What does the research actually show?
The evidence base for multidisciplinary wound care is consistent in direction but limited in design quality. Here is an honest summary.
Strongest signal: diabetic foot ulcer and major amputation.
The systematic review of 33 observational studies remains the most cited aggregate finding: 31 of 33 studies reported reduced major amputations after MDT introduction. Common team elements across those studies included medical and surgical disciplines, a team captain, care algorithms, and the four core tasks (glycemic control, local wound management, vascular assessment, infection control).
Reported major-amputation reductions across single-center MDT program reports ranged from minimal change to absolute reductions of up to 51% in select high-performing settings, with wide variability by population and team structure.
Diagnostic and healing improvements.
The Ontario interprofessional cohort study demonstrated that team-based assessments improved healability classification, increased vascular and offloading evaluations, detected infection more reliably, and produced better healing outcomes with fewer advanced modalities compared to conventional community care.
Pressure injuries and other wound types.
Evidence for team-based care in pressure injury management shows prevalence and healing improvements, but the systematic review of pressure-ulcer team interventions notes that the evidence base is mainly observational and that randomized-trial data remain sparse.
Key limitations to keep in mind:
- No large randomized controlled trials exist for MDT wound care
- Team composition and outcome definitions vary across studies
- Most evidence comes from single centers with motivated teams
- Generalizability to community settings with limited specialist access is uncertain
The honest conclusion: the evidence consistently points in the same direction, but the magnitude of benefit depends heavily on team quality, patient selection, and how early referral happens.

An editorial perspective on what MDT care actually demands
The evidence for multidisciplinary wound care is compelling, but there is a gap between what the research describes and what patients often encounter in practice. Most studies credit well-organized, highly motivated teams operating in academic or specialty centers. The average community wound clinic may have a podiatrist and a wound-care nurse, with vascular and infectious disease involvement that is more aspirational than routine.
That gap does not mean patients should give up on the MDT model. It means they should ask harder questions. A team that meets weekly, uses a written care algorithm, and tracks its own healing rates is operating at a fundamentally different level than one that coordinates informally. The difference in outcomes reflects that difference in structure.
Early referral is the variable patients and caregivers control most directly. Waiting until a wound is infected to the bone or the foot is ischemic hands the team a much harder problem. A wound that has not improved after two to three weeks of standard care deserves an MDT evaluation, not another month of the same dressing.
